This article explains how to create a custom report in Salesforce to view tasks associated with Work.com Goals (WDC). There is no pre-built report type for Goal tasks, so you must first create a custom report type that relates Goals to Activities.

Solución

To report on Goal tasks in Salesforce Work.com (WDC), you need to first create a Custom Report Type linking Goals to Activities, then create a report from that type:

  1. Login to Salesforce and go to Setup and enter Report Types in the search box.
  2. Select Report Types and Continue if the "What is a Custom Report Type" dialog displays.
  3. Click the New Custom Report Type button.
  4. Select Goals as your primary object then fill in the remaining information and hit Next button.
  5. Click the Click to relate to another object link and select Activities from the picklist.
  6. Select the '"A" records may or may not have related "B" records option and hit the Save button.
  7. Go to the Reports tab and create a new report based on the report type you created. This report will contain fields from the goal and related tasks.

    For more details on creating and customizing reports review the at Reports and Dashboards Quick Start page.
